Flight
Curbside—John Hirsch Mainstage
This incredible movement piece was a joy to watch. Based on the classic story ‘The Little Prince’, This new telling was visually stunning to watch. I loved watching these three talented acrobats flow seamlessly from one scene to the next. With no set whatsoever, I was spellbound the entire time. Fans of the story may not love some of the changes that have been made for the purpose of this production. It is alluded to at the very beginning that this is a sort of sequel to the original, but the story is relatively the same. In this telling for example, instead of traveling through space, we travel through the sea. Instead of visiting planets, we visit islands. I found some of the nuances and metaphors were lost but the story seemed to have a more light and whimsical feel to it. This is a great one to take your whole family too and a definite treat to brighten anyone’s day.
